当前位置:首页 > 内存 > 正文

Oracle共享内存不足

  • 内存
  • 2024-09-05 09:35:17
  • 4038

一、如何解决ORACLE共享内存不足的方法蚕是最美丽的。ORACLE例程的系统全局区域(SGA)包括多个内存区域(包括缓冲区高速缓存、共享池、Java池、大型池和重做日志缓冲区)。SGA=db_cache+shared_pool+java_pool+。big_pool的处理方式:手动调整SGA的大小,然后分配四个主内存区域的大小。首先增加共享内存缓冲区高速缓存。sql>showparametersga_max_size//查看最大SGA值sql>showparametershared_pool//查看共享内存sql>showparameterdb_cache//查看数据缓存sql>altersystemsetsga_max_size=500Mscope=spfile;//更改最大SGA值sql>altersystemsetshared_pool_size=200Mscope=spfile;//编辑共享内存sql>altersystemsetdb_cache_size=250Mscope=spfile;//更改数据缓存
二、在安装Oracle11g2的时候说环境不满足最低要求是怎么回事!

安装Oracle11g2时,环境不满足最低要求的原因是系统错误导致的。

具体解决步骤如下:

1.首先打开电脑,选择从Oracle官网或其他网站下载的Oracle数据库的两个压缩文件,右键单击,选择【解压缩文件】。请注意,您需要将两个压缩文件解压到同一文件夹中。

2.在弹出的【解压路径和选项】界面的【目标路径】框中输入解压后的文件位置和文件名。

3.解压完成后,双击运行【】开始安装。

4.此时弹出提示框【INS-13001环境不满足最低要求】。此时可以选择【是】继续安装;您也可以选择【否】结束安装并修改配置,避免再次弹出该提示。

5.在解压后的Oracle安装文件目录中,找到stage\cvu\cvu_文件。

6.打开[cvu_]文件,找到value=windows7的OPERATING_SYSTEM部分,复制整个部分,并修改Release=6.2,value=windows10;

如下:<架构

就是这样。



扩展信息


Oracle采用并行服务器模式,而SybaseSQLServer采用虚拟服务器模式。它不会将一个查询分解为多个子查询,然后在不同的CPU上同时执行这些子查询。可以说,在对称多处理方面,Oracle的性能优于Sybase的性能。

系统运行后业务量往往会增加。如果数据库数量达到GB以上,我们可以从两个方面来提升系统的性能。一是提高单台服务器的性能,二是提高单台服务器的性能。只需增加服务器数量即可。

基于此,如果我们要提高单台服务器的性能,最好选择Oracle数据库,因为它们可以在对称多CPU系统上提供并行处理。

相反,由于Sybase的导航服务器将Internet上的所有用户注册到导航服务器上,并通过导航服务提出数据访问请求,因此导航服务器将用户的请求分解,然后自动将其定向到导航服务器上。受其控制。我们可以选择多个SQLServer来提供基于分散数据的并行处理能力。

这些是在其他条件和环境相同的情况下进行比较的,这样才有可比性。在数据分布更新方面,Oracle采用基于服务器的自动2PC(两阶段提交),而Sybase则采用基于客户端DB-Library或CT-Library的可编程2PC。

因此,在选择数据库时,一定要根据自己的需求来选择。例如,如果从事社保软件开发,考虑到数据量大、并发操作多、实时性要求高,基本都是采用ORACLE作为后端。数据库。

Oracle服务器由Oracle数据库和Oracle实例组成。Oracle实例由系统全局区内存结构和用于管理数据库的后台进程组成。


三、oracle在安装dbca时,报错:ORA:04031关于sharedMemory,我应该怎么调呢这意味着在DBCA过程中默认的共享内存分配可能不够。在DBCA中,您使用customer选项而不是典型安装,指定更大的共享内存,然后重试。
四、安装oracle11g的时候为什么说我配置内存失败了?从理论上讲,不能否认“或2012”是指内存不足,但如果当前机器的配置一般不符合要求。由于内存不足而导致失败的可能性不大。
以下是ORACLE11g的内存要求:
物理内存(RAM)至少1GB
双RAM作为虚拟内存
如果安装在下面。win7以管理员身份运行;ORACLE可以检查环境可用性以确保服务器服务已启用并且C盘是默认共享。